At 4m long and 2.5m wide, the Lagoon creates a noticeably more expansive feel than many plunge pools while remaining practical for tighter blocks and modern home designs. Its clean rectangular profile gives it a timeless architectural look that suits contemporary landscaping particularly well, while the integrated side-entry steps preserve the majority of the shell for open water space.
What makes the Lagoon especially appealing is its depth profile. Ranging from 1.29m to 1.6m, it delivers a more immersive in-water experience than most compact pools on the market. | Lagoon | |
|---|---|
| Length | 4.0 m |
| Width | 2.5 m |
| Depth (shallow end) | 1.29 m |
| Depth (deep end) | 1.60 m |
| Approx. water volume | ~10,000 L |
The Lagoon features a sleek rectangular shell with a highly efficient interior layout that maximises usable swim and relaxation space.
Integrated side-entry steps are positioned neatly in one corner, creating easy access without interrupting the openness of the pool itself. Along the side wall, a clean bench transition subtly defines the entry zone while preserving a large uninterrupted water area through the centre and deep end.

Like every AquaVale shell, the Lagoon is manufactured using premium multi-layer fibreglass composite engineered specifically for Australian conditions. The structure is designed to remain stable through temperature variation, UV exposure, and natural ground movement while maintaining its long-term integrity.
Its smooth gelcoat surface is UV-stable, non-porous, and naturally resistant to algae and mineral build-up. That means less cleaning, lower ongoing maintenance requirements, and water that stays clearer with less effort.

Delivery of pool and spa shells is handled differently from standard pool equipment because each shell needs to be produced, scheduled and transported by truck.
Before delivery can take place, your pool or spa shell must first be manufactured. Production lead times can vary, but may be up to 3 weeks, depending on the model, finish, production schedule and seasonal demand.
Once the shell is ready, delivery is arranged by truck to the agreed delivery address. Because of the size and weight of the shell, the delivery must be carefully coordinated in advance.
A standard shell delivery includes up to 1.5 hours on site for unloading and placement coordination. If the truck is required to remain on site for longer than this, additional waiting time will be charged in 15-minute increments.
Additional charges may also apply if delivery is delayed, access is not suitable, the crane is not ready, the site is not prepared, or the shell cannot be unloaded safely at the scheduled time. We will provide delivery details and timing information before dispatch so the client, installer and crane operator can coordinate the site delivery properly.
